BILLINGS, Mont. – Billings Public Library is hosting two charitable drives to support foster children and the community in Yellowstone County, according to the library via Facebook.

The first initiative is a pajama drive for kids and teens in foster care. The library encourages residents to donate new pajamas in any size. This drive is sponsored by the Junior League of Billings.

"Help make this Christmas a little warmer and brighter for kids in need," the library said.

In addition to the pajama drive, the library is also collecting new socks, gloves and hand warmers. Donors can place these items in the Book Lockers return bins at any library location. The library's locker team will ensure all donations are gathered and placed in the library's Community Cabinet.
